Diaspora Kapita set to invest US$600,000 in digital bank Jamboo

Diaspora Kapita, a well-established investment firm, has announced its intention to invest $600,000 in Jamboo during its capital raising phase in the early months of 2024. This strategic move aims to position Diaspora Kapita as a leader in establishing a pioneering wealth and investment platform focused on Africa.

Jamboo stands out as an innovative digital solution providing banking and investment services tailored to members of the African diaspora residing in the UK and Europe. It distinguishes itself as the first digital platform catering to the financial needs of this particular demographic.

Vhusi Phiri, CEO of Diaspora Kapita, highlighted that the partnership marks a crucial step for Zimbabwean investors seeking to broaden their investment scope beyond national borders. This collaboration presents an exciting opportunity for diaspora investors to engage in and acquire assets that consistently add value across the African diaspora. The initiative aims to go beyond remittances, aiming for comprehensive ownership of the value chain.

Takwana Tyaranini, CEO of Jamboo, expressed optimism about the partnership with Diaspora Kapita, a renowned entity poised to unlock numerous opportunities. This collaboration offers a streamlined avenue for the African diaspora to strategically invest their resources and actively contribute to shaping Africa’s economic landscape. This innovative venture underscores a commitment to fostering financial empowerment and growth within the African community, marking the dawn of a new era in investment opportunities.

The Jamboo app is designed to provide users with flexibility in growing their funds and accessing them as needed. Currently, more than 2000 individuals have expressed interest in becoming beta testers. The demo app has already been distributed to over 300 early-stage investors, with the company focused on enhancing its features and framework ahead of its official launch.

This collaboration between Jamboo and Diaspora Kapita holds the potential to revolutionize the investment landscape, serving as a gateway for global investors to tap into lucrative opportunities within African economies. With remittances from the Zimbabwean diaspora alone surpassing $2 billion, this initiative contributes significantly to total remittances to Africa, which now exceed $100 billion.
